PuSh Festival Online Event: I Swallowed a Moon made of Iron 我咽下一枚铁做的月亮

In this haunting song cycle, composer and performer Njo Kong Kie 楊光奇 sets the poetry of Xu Lizhi 許立志 to song and delivers a lamentation for our digital age. Xu toiled in a factory in Shenzhen, China, where he, along with hundreds of thousands of others who were unseen and ignored, manufactured the digital devices […]

Crafted Vancouver

Crafted Vancouver is an annual 25-day celebration that presents and advances outstanding local, Canadian and International craftsmanship and creativity through a curated program of events taking place in venues throughout Metro Vancouver & the Fraser Valley. This year they debut six official Creative Districts, each with its own unique character and identity; Armoury District, Chinatown, […]
